Fine motor skills are essential for young children's development as they involve the coordination of small muscle movements, specifically in the hands and fingers. Engaging in activities like Fine Motor Skills Easy Math Coloring Pages for ages 4-8 serves multiple developmental purposes.

First, these coloring pages cater to children's creativity while simultaneously introducing basic math concepts. By integrating math with artistic expression, children learn to associate numbers with tangible activities, enhancing their understanding and retention.

Second, coloring demands precise control, aiding in the development of fine motor skills needed for writing and other tasks. As children manipulate crayons or markers, they strengthen hand-eye coordination and finger dexterity, laying the foundation for effective writing, crafting, and other skill-based activities.

Additionally, these activities promote focus and patience, skills crucial for academic and social success. By allowing children to express themselves creatively while learning fundamental math skills, parents and teachers can create a holistic educational environment.

Incorporating Fine Motor Skills Easy Math Coloring Pages keeps learning playful and engaging, making them a valuable resource for parents and educators. Investing time in these activities paves the way for children's future learning and personal development.
